The Bible is a collection of sacred texts that are considered holy by Christians. It's divided into two main sections:


1. The Old Testament: Contains stories, wisdom, and prophecies from before the birth of Jesus Christ.

2. The New Testament: Focuses on the life, teachings, death, and resurrection of Jesus Christ and the early Christian Church.
